Senator O'Meara appeared to be a little concerned about publication of the register. It must be realised that this is a targeted register as it relates to personal injuries proceedings. While, as the Senator rightly said, the will of everyone who dies is published in the probate office and the Revenue make certain statements also, this register is being created for the specific purpose of enabling those who must meet personal injuries claims to carry out research on the persons bringing the claims. In the case of such a register, universal disclosure might lead to people's private matters being analysed by others unnecessarily.
